The new mine is based on an initial open pit mining operation with a 9year mine life, designed to process million tonnes of ore per year to produce 260,000 metric tonne units ("mtu") of tungsten trioxide (WO3) per year, or 2,060 tonnes of tungsten metal, contained in a highquality concentrate, following the one year rampup period.

Tungsten Carbide does not tarnish and is substantially heavier in weight when compared to other metals. It is important to note, that with hardness comes brittleness. If a Tungsten ring is dropped or severely knocked on a hard surface, it can potentially fracture the ring. BROWSE TUNGSTEN RINGS » More About Tungsten

Tungsten, or wolfram, is a chemical element with symbol W and atomic number 74. The name tungsten comes from the former Swedish name for the tungstate mineral scheelite, tung sten or "heavy stone". Tungsten is a rare metal found naturally on Earth almost exclusively combined with other elements in chemical compounds rather than alone.
